4.
System Auto Shut Down Algorithm
Oscillation detect level
At external input signal over -30dBm
Re-check Algorithm Time Action 0~1sec Upon detection, check for the status for 1 sec 2~60sec Shutdown 61~62sec Shutdown status clear, check for the status for 1sec 63~122sec Shutdown 123~124sec Shutdown status clear, check for the status for 1 sec After Repeat
Program verification available upon request
5.
System Auto Level Control Algorithm
ALC(Automatic Level Control) operates at 1dB step to maintain the output level of 10dBm when the
input signal is from -60dBm to –30dBm.(30dB range)

6.
System Operation
The Powertec RIF800 “over the air” Repeater is designed for indoor operation to
increase signal strength in small and medium sized areas such as offices, shops and
basement car parks in the GSM band, with frequencies that are programmable to the
specific requirements of each site. It is small, lightweight, and easy to install. Simply plug it
in, and the coverage will be immediately extended. The uplink and downlink gain of the
repeater can be adjusted by ALC.

Installation Process
This is one of the most important process in repeater installation, as how to install the antenna
decides performance of this equipment.
1. Decide a place to install the outdoor antenna considering the cable
length of the donor antenna.
2. Attach the antenna bracket at the wall.
(Refer image A)

8.
Trouble shooting
When Power LED (GREEN) off
1) Check the AC Power.
2) IF AC power is OK, Check the DC Power by checking Power Supply.
When Alarm LED (RED) ON
1) Check the Isolation between Donor ANT. and Service ANT.
When no LED blinks at FWD LEVEL LED
Check the FWD Input Power level whether it is in normal range.
